The Law Office of Lainey Feingold and Co-counsel Linda Dardarian have negotiated close to a dozen agreements with national retailers requiring telephone-style keypads at point of sale devices so that people who are blind do not have to disclose their PIN when using a PIN-based card.The California Financial Code requires that all point of sale devices in the state be equipped with “a tactually discernible numerical keypad similar to a telephone keypad.” Read more about California tactile keypad law.The Department of Justice Standards for Talking ATMs require that numeric keys “shall be arranged in a 12-key ascending or descending telephone keypad layout.” Read more about United States Talking ATM requirements.Karlin’s Telephone Keypad: A “key” element of disability access Next time you use a keypad, you can thank John E. Apple has shown that a touchscreen can be made accessible, but in the absence of tactile keypads, significant swaths of today’s technology and electronics are off limits to persons who cannot see, and to others with disabilities as well.Īs with many ubiquitous elements of the built environment, we often fail to appreciate the origins - or the originator– of the technology we rely on. Tactile keypads are a crucial element of accessibility for people who are blind and visually impaired.
